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

SQL Server 2005 Á¬½Ó×Ö·û´®

Ô­ÎÄת×Ô http://blog.csdn.net/jyh_jack/archive/2008/04/07/2257512.aspx
SQL Native Client ODBC Driver
 
±ê×¼°²È«Á¬½Ó
   
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
 
ÄúÊÇ·ñÔÚʹÓÃSQL Server 2005 Express£¿ ÇëÔÚ“Server”Ñ¡ÏîʹÓÃÁ¬½Ó±í´ïʽ“Ö÷»úÃû³Æ\SQLEXPRESS”¡£ 
  
ÊÜÐŵÄÁ¬½Ó
   
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Trusted_Connection=yes;
 
"Integrated Security=SSPI" Óë "Trusted_Connection=yes" ÊÇÏàͬµÄ¡£
  
Á¬½Óµ½Ò»¸öSQL ServerʵÀý
Ö¸¶¨·þÎñÆ÷ʵÀýµÄ±í´ïʽºÍÆäËûSQL ServerµÄÁ¬½Ó×Ö·û´®Ïàͬ¡£  
Driver={SQL Native Client};Server=myServerName\theInstanceName;Database=myDataBase;Trusted_Connection=yes;
 
   
Ö¸¶¨Óû§ÃûºÍÃÜÂë
oConn.Properties("Prompt") = adPromptAlways
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;
 
   
ʹÓÃMARS (multiple active result sets)
   
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Trusted_Connection=yes;MARS_Connection=yes;
 
"MultipleActiveResultSets=true"ÓëMARS_Connection=yes"ÊÇÏàͬµÄ¡£
ʹÓÃADO.NET 2.0×÷ΪMARSµÄÄ£¿é¡£ MARS²»Ö§³ÖADO.NET 1.0ºÍADO.NET 1.1¡£
  
ÑéÖ¤ÍøÂçÊý¾Ý
   
Driver={SQL Native Client};Server=myServerAddress;Database=myDataBase;Trusted_Connection=yes;Encrypt=yes;
 
   
ʹÓø½¼Ó±¾µØÊý¾Ý¿âÎļþµÄ·½Ê½Á¬½Óµ½±¾µØSQL Server ExpressʵÀý
   
Driver={SQL Native Client};Server=.\SQLExpress;AttachDbFilename=c:\asd\qwe\mydbfile.mdf; Database=dbname;Trusted_Connection=Yes;
 
ΪºÎҪʹÓÃDatabase²ÎÊý£¿Èç¹ûͬÃûµÄÊý¾Ý¿âÒѾ­±»¸½¼Ó£¬ÄÇôSQL Server½«²»»áÖØÐ¸½¼Ó¡£ 
  
ʹÓø½¼Ó±¾µØÊý¾ÝÎļþ¼ÐÖеÄÊý¾Ý¿âÎļþµÄ·½Ê½Á¬½Óµ½±¾µØSQL Server ExpressʵÀý
   
Driver={SQL Native Client};Server=.\SQLE


Ïà¹ØÎĵµ£º

ÔÚlinuxÉÏÅäÖÃunixODBCºÍFreeTDS·ÃÎÊMS SQL Server.

Ò», °²×° unixODBC
ÏÂÔØ°²×°°ü. ÔÚ RedHat °²×°¹âÅÌÉϾÍÓÐ
unixODBC-2.2.11-1.RHEL4.1.i386.rpm
unixODBC-devel-2.2.11-1.RHEL4.1.i386.rpm
unixODBC-kde-2.2.11-1.RHEL4.1.i386.rpm
°²×°
rpm -Uvh unixODBC-2.2.11-1.RHEL4.1.i386.rpm
rpm -Uvh unixODBC-devel-2.2.11-1.RHEL4.1.i386.rpm
Èç¹û°²×°ÖÐÌáʾÓÐ¶ÔÆäËü° ......

sql server2005 rownumͨÓô洢¹ý³Ì·ÖÒ³

set ANSI_NULLS ON
set QUOTED_IDENTIFIER ON
go
ALTER   PROCEDURE [dbo].[sp_GetRecordfromPage]
@TableName varchar(350),        --±íÃû
@Fields varchar(5000) = '*',    --×Ö¶ÎÃû(È«²¿×Ö¶ÎΪ*)
@OrderField varchar(5000),   &nbs ......

SQL Server·þÎñÆ÷½ÇÉ«ÓëÊý¾Ý¿â½ÇÉ«Çø±ð

¹Ì¶¨·þÎñÆ÷½ÇÉ«
sysadmin ¿ÉÒÔÔÚ SQL Server ÖÐÖ´ÐÐÈκλ¡£
serveradmin ¿ÉÒÔÉèÖ÷þÎñÆ÷·¶Î§µÄÅäÖÃÑ¡Ï¹Ø±Õ·þÎñÆ÷¡£
setupadmin ¿ÉÒÔ¹ÜÀíÁ´½Ó·þÎñÆ÷ºÍÆô¶¯¹ý³Ì¡£
securityadmin ¿ÉÒÔ¹ÜÀíµÇ¼ºÍ CREATE DATABASE ȨÏÞ£¬»¹¿ÉÒÔ¶ÁÈ¡´íÎóÈÕÖ¾ºÍ¸ü¸ÄÃÜÂë¡£
processadmin ¿ÉÒÔ¹ÜÀíÔÚ SQL Server ÖÐÔËÐеĽø³Ì¡£
......

sql¸ñʽ»¯ÈÕÆÚ

Select CONVERT(varchar(100), GETDATE(), 0): 05 16 2010 10:57AM
Select CONVERT(varchar(100), GETDATE(), 1): 05/16/06
Select CONVERT(varchar(100), GETDATE(), 2): 06.05.16
Select CONVERT(varchar(100), GETDATE(), 3): 16/05/06
Select CONVERT(varchar(100), GETDATE(), 4): 16.05.06
Select CONVERT(varch ......

IBatisNet SQL ServerµÄfloatÀàÐÍת»»Îªc# float³ö´í

½ñÌìдһ¸öÉÌÆ·µÄÐ޸ŦÄÜʱÓöµ½µÄÎÊÌâ
ÉÌÆ·ÖÐÖØÁ¿ weight µÄÊý¾Ý¿â(SQL Server2005)ÀàÐͶ¨ÒåΪ float
ÔÚmappings ÖÐת»»Îªc#ÀàÐ͵ÄÒ»¾äΪ
<result property="Goods_Weight" column="Goods_Weight" type="float" dbType="float"/>
°´Àí˵Õâ¸ö float ÊÇÒ»ÑùµÄ£¬×ª»»ÍêÈ«²»»á³öÏÖÎÊÌ⣬
ʵ¼Ê³ÌÐòÔËÐÐʱ£¬ÏµÍ³±¨´í 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